What is an equation of the line that passes through the points (-1,3) and
(-1, 6)?

Respuesta :

Yang100
Yang100 Yang100
  • 26-04-2021

Answer:

x=-1

Step-by-step explanation:

m=(y2-y1)/(x2-x1)

m=(6-3)/(-1-(-1))

m=3/(-1+1)

m=3/0

slope is undefined.

x=-1
